سلام دکمه ویرایش رو هم که فرمودید آموزش بدید ممنون میشم یه سوال دیگه : دکمه ها بعداز چند وقت غیرفعال میشه باید دوباره بسازم مشکلش از چی میتونه باشه؟ کد دکمه جدید (ثبت رکورد جدید) هم بفرمایید ممنون میشم
1. خرابی فرم یا دیتابیس: گاهی ممکن است که فایل Access خراب شود و باعث شود که اجزای مختلف، از جمله دکمهها، به درستی کار نکنند. راهحل: از ابزار Compact and Repair در Access استفاده کنید. این ابزار میتواند خرابیهای احتمالی در دیتابیس شما را برطرف کند. مسیر این ابزار به صورت زیر است: File > Info > Compact and Repair Database 2. کد VBA خراب یا ناسازگار: اگر دکمهها با استفاده از کد VBA کار میکنند، ممکن است مشکلی در کد وجود داشته باشد که باعث از کار افتادن دکمهها میشود. همچنین اگر دیتابیس بهروزرسانی شده یا به نسخه دیگری از Access منتقل شده باشد، کدهای قدیمی ممکن است ناسازگار شوند. راهحل: کدهای VBA را بررسی کنید تا مطمئن شوید که هیچ خطای منطقی یا syntax error در کد وجود ندارد. همچنین اگر با انتقال دیتابیس به نسخه جدید Access مواجه هستید، ممکن است نیاز به تغییر یا بهروزرسانی کدها داشته باشید. 3. آسیب دیدن مراجع (References): در کدهای VBA، Access برای استفاده از برخی ویژگیها نیاز به مراجع خاصی (References) دارد. اگر این مراجع آسیب ببینند یا گم شوند، دکمهها ممکن است به درستی کار نکنند. راهحل: به مسیر زیر بروید و مطمئن شوید که تمامی مراجع مورد نیاز سالم و فعال هستند: در پنجره VBA Editor (Alt + F11)، Tools > References را انتخاب کنید. اگر خطای "Missing" در کنار هر یک از مراجع وجود دارد، آن مرجع را پیدا و مجدد تنظیم کنید یا اگر نیاز نیست، غیرفعال کنید. 4. مشکل در رویدادهای فرم (Form Events): ممکن است دکمهها به رویدادهای فرم متصل شده باشند که به درستی اجرا نمیشوند. به عنوان مثال، رویدادهای Form Load یا Form Current میتوانند بر فعال بودن دکمهها تأثیر بگذارند. راهحل: مطمئن شوید که تمامی رویدادهای فرم به درستی تعریف شدهاند و کدی که در این رویدادها نوشته شده است، به درستی اجرا میشود. 5. مسائل مربوط به امنیت ماکروها: اگر تنظیمات امنیتی Access بالا باشد، ممکن است ماکروها یا VBA به طور کامل غیرفعال شوند و در نتیجه دکمهها کار نکنند. راهحل: مطمئن شوید که تنظیمات امنیت ماکرو در Access به درستی تنظیم شده است: File > Options > Trust Center > Trust Center Settings > Macro Settings. گزینهای را انتخاب کنید که به اجرای ماکروهای مورد اعتماد اجازه میدهد. 6. خرابی لینکهای خارجی: اگر دکمهها به منابع خارجی (مانند جداول مرتبط، فایلها یا گزارشهای خارجی) وابسته باشند و این منابع دچار مشکل یا تغییر آدرس شده باشند، ممکن است دکمهها غیرفعال شوند. راهحل: لینکهای مرتبط با منابع خارجی را بررسی کنید و اطمینان حاصل کنید که به درستی کار میکنند. 7. بهروزرسانیهای ویندوز یا آفیس: گاهی بهروزرسانیهای ویندوز یا Office ممکن است باعث ناسازگاری در عملکرد دیتابیس شود، به خصوص اگر از یک نسخه قدیمیتر از Access استفاده میکنید. راهحل: مطمئن شوید که Access و ویندوز شما بهروز هستند و اگر پس از بهروزرسانی مشکلی پیش آمد، سعی کنید به نسخه قبلی بازگردید یا یک بهروزرسانی جدیدتر نصب کنید. 8. مشکل در فایلهای موقت Access: Access فایلهای موقت (Temporary Files) را ایجاد میکند و در برخی موارد این فایلها ممکن است دچار مشکل شوند و عملکرد دکمهها را مختل کنند. راهحل: فایلهای موقت را پاک کنید یا سیستم را ریاستارت کنید تا فایلهای جدید ایجاد شوند.
خیییلی عالی ❤❤❤❤
خوشحالم که راضی هستید
🌷🌷🌷
😇
ممنون از آموزش کاربردی تون
😇
عالی بود
😇
عالی
😇
سلام
دکمه ویرایش رو هم که فرمودید آموزش بدید ممنون میشم
یه سوال دیگه : دکمه ها بعداز چند وقت غیرفعال میشه باید دوباره بسازم مشکلش از چی میتونه باشه؟
کد دکمه جدید (ثبت رکورد جدید) هم بفرمایید ممنون میشم
سلام سعی میکنم آموزش ها روبه زودی بذارم
برای سوال تون یک پاسخ کاملی میفرستم ممکن هسا یکی از اینها باشه
1. خرابی فرم یا دیتابیس:
گاهی ممکن است که فایل Access خراب شود و باعث شود که اجزای مختلف، از جمله دکمهها، به درستی کار نکنند.
راهحل: از ابزار Compact and Repair در Access استفاده کنید. این ابزار میتواند خرابیهای احتمالی در دیتابیس شما را برطرف کند. مسیر این ابزار به صورت زیر است:
File > Info > Compact and Repair Database
2. کد VBA خراب یا ناسازگار:
اگر دکمهها با استفاده از کد VBA کار میکنند، ممکن است مشکلی در کد وجود داشته باشد که باعث از کار افتادن دکمهها میشود. همچنین اگر دیتابیس بهروزرسانی شده یا به نسخه دیگری از Access منتقل شده باشد، کدهای قدیمی ممکن است ناسازگار شوند.
راهحل: کدهای VBA را بررسی کنید تا مطمئن شوید که هیچ خطای منطقی یا syntax error در کد وجود ندارد. همچنین اگر با انتقال دیتابیس به نسخه جدید Access مواجه هستید، ممکن است نیاز به تغییر یا بهروزرسانی کدها داشته باشید.
3. آسیب دیدن مراجع (References):
در کدهای VBA، Access برای استفاده از برخی ویژگیها نیاز به مراجع خاصی (References) دارد. اگر این مراجع آسیب ببینند یا گم شوند، دکمهها ممکن است به درستی کار نکنند.
راهحل: به مسیر زیر بروید و مطمئن شوید که تمامی مراجع مورد نیاز سالم و فعال هستند:
در پنجره VBA Editor (Alt + F11)، Tools > References را انتخاب کنید. اگر خطای "Missing" در کنار هر یک از مراجع وجود دارد، آن مرجع را پیدا و مجدد تنظیم کنید یا اگر نیاز نیست، غیرفعال کنید.
4. مشکل در رویدادهای فرم (Form Events):
ممکن است دکمهها به رویدادهای فرم متصل شده باشند که به درستی اجرا نمیشوند. به عنوان مثال، رویدادهای Form Load یا Form Current میتوانند بر فعال بودن دکمهها تأثیر بگذارند.
راهحل: مطمئن شوید که تمامی رویدادهای فرم به درستی تعریف شدهاند و کدی که در این رویدادها نوشته شده است، به درستی اجرا میشود.
5. مسائل مربوط به امنیت ماکروها:
اگر تنظیمات امنیتی Access بالا باشد، ممکن است ماکروها یا VBA به طور کامل غیرفعال شوند و در نتیجه دکمهها کار نکنند.
راهحل: مطمئن شوید که تنظیمات امنیت ماکرو در Access به درستی تنظیم شده است:
File > Options > Trust Center > Trust Center Settings > Macro Settings. گزینهای را انتخاب کنید که به اجرای ماکروهای مورد اعتماد اجازه میدهد.
6. خرابی لینکهای خارجی:
اگر دکمهها به منابع خارجی (مانند جداول مرتبط، فایلها یا گزارشهای خارجی) وابسته باشند و این منابع دچار مشکل یا تغییر آدرس شده باشند، ممکن است دکمهها غیرفعال شوند.
راهحل: لینکهای مرتبط با منابع خارجی را بررسی کنید و اطمینان حاصل کنید که به درستی کار میکنند.
7. بهروزرسانیهای ویندوز یا آفیس:
گاهی بهروزرسانیهای ویندوز یا Office ممکن است باعث ناسازگاری در عملکرد دیتابیس شود، به خصوص اگر از یک نسخه قدیمیتر از Access استفاده میکنید.
راهحل: مطمئن شوید که Access و ویندوز شما بهروز هستند و اگر پس از بهروزرسانی مشکلی پیش آمد، سعی کنید به نسخه قبلی بازگردید یا یک بهروزرسانی جدیدتر نصب کنید.
8. مشکل در فایلهای موقت Access:
Access فایلهای موقت (Temporary Files) را ایجاد میکند و در برخی موارد این فایلها ممکن است دچار مشکل شوند و عملکرد دکمهها را مختل کنند.
راهحل: فایلهای موقت را پاک کنید یا سیستم را ریاستارت کنید تا فایلهای جدید ایجاد شوند.